When it gets dark, I can’t see the toggle switches on my dash for my horn, navigation lights, shower, etc. I would like to have them lit individually from behind the switch. I guess a glow in the dark kind of thing. Any ideas on how to go about that?
 
These switches are industry standard Carling switches. So you can replace them with the thousands of third party switches on Ebay and Amazon. Just look at the ones with a wiring schematic, as you will want ones that you can tie that light in with your dash power, or running lights if you only want them on after dark.
